How To Get Into Vanderbilt University

Joining a prestigious institute like Vanderbilt University can be daunting for a majority of undergraduates. If you are also assessing your chances, here is a guide to tell all that you should know about Vandy and its admission procedure. Vandy or Vanderbilt is a private university in Nashville, Tennessee running 4, 5, and 6 years’ courses. It offers selected programs for thousands of aspirants. As per the latest statistical data, it has more than 14, 000 students on roll for various full-time and part-time courses. To seek admission in this university, you must focus on certain critical aspects like: -SAT scores -GPA requirements -Process of Admission But before all this, it is essential to know what this college can offer to you as an undergraduate. What to expect at Vanderbilt University ? Vanderbilt has an impressive campus in the southwest of Nashville. It has a walking distance from many prominent landmarks and student stuff. It offers the best professional programs in Law, Medicine, and Engineering. It has excellent student support services and career center along with a plenty of other meaningful resources. Vanderbilt also offers financial aid and merit scholarships to the deserving students. GPA requirements to  get into Vanderbilt University Due to its acceptance rate of 14%, it can be easily comprehended that Vandy is extremely selective even for the most qualified aspirants. It requires high scores apart from impressive essays, extracurricular, and recommendations to get admission. GPA requirement for this university is nearly 3.76 out of 4. So, you have to perform exceptionally above average in your high school and attend AP or IB classes to compensate for being an under scorer. If your GPA is lower than this, you have to improve your SAT scores to better your chances. SAT score required to get into Vanderbilt University : Remember that Vanderbilt is a highly competitive university requiring its students to perform brilliantly in academics. The average composite New SAT score requirement for Vandy is 1490 out of 1600 for the freshman admission while it accepts composite scores at 1410 as well. It follows the policy of Highest Section for choosing your SAT scores. It implies that you can send your highest SAT scores to the school. This policy is also known as super scoring.
